Chapter 2: Understanding the Sandvik Coromant Coroplus Tool Library Add-in

The Sandvik Coromant Coroplus Tool Library Add-in is a valuable resource for Fusion 360 users, providing a comprehensive database of machining tools. By utilizing this add-in, businesses can access a vast array of tooling options, ranging from end mills to turning inserts. This extensive library ensures that manufacturers have access to the most suitable tools for their specific machining requirements.

Step 1: Setting up Project Parameters

Before starting the machining process, it is crucial to define the project parameters. This involves determining the material, stock dimensions, and other relevant specifications. These initial settings lay the foundation for accurate machining and optimal utilization of the Coroplus Tool Library Add-in.

Step 2: Selecting the Tool

The second step entails selecting the appropriate tool from the Sandvik Coromant Coroplus Tool Library. Based on the material and machining requirements, Fusion 360 provides recommendations for the most suitable tools. This intelligent feature saves time and helps ensure optimal precision.

Step 3: Defining Machining Strategies

Once the tool selection is complete, Fusion 360 allows users to define machining strategies based on their specific needs. From roughing to finishing operations, the software offers various options to accommodate diverse machining requirements. These strategies significantly enhance efficiency and quality.

Step 4: Simulation and Verification

After defining the machining strategies, Fusion 360 enables users to simulate and verify the entire process. This simulation functionality provides a clear visualization of the machining workflow, allowing manufacturers to identify any potential issues or collisions. By eliminating errors beforehand, costly mistakes are avoided during the actual production.

Step 5: Generating the Toolpath

Once the simulation and verification are satisfactory, Fusion 360 generates the toolpath automatically. This digital representation of the machining operations ensures accurate execution and eliminates guesswork. The Coroplus Tool Library Add-in plays a crucial role in ensuring the toolpath aligns with the selected tools, maximizing machining efficiency.

Step 6: Post-processing and Finalizing

The final step involves post-processing and finalizing the machining setup. Fusion 360 provides various options for customizing the output, generating reports, and exporting the toolpath. By utilizing these capabilities, manufacturers can streamline their processes and seamlessly integrate machining data into their manufacturing workflows.
